Key Characteristics of Chamaedorea Palm
Multi-Year Lifecycle π±
The Chamaedorea Palm boasts a fascinating lifecycle that spans several years, often exceeding a decade. It transitions from a juvenile stage to a mature plant, showcasing its resilience and adaptability.
Growth Patterns and Regrowth from Roots πΏ
This palm exhibits a unique growth habit, capable of producing multiple stems from a single root system. Typically, it grows slowly, averaging about 6 to 12 inches per year.
Root Regrowth Mechanism
One of the remarkable features of the Chamaedorea Palm is its ability to regrow from established roots each year. Maintaining healthy roots is crucial for the overall vitality of the plant, ensuring it thrives for years to come.

Growth and Lifespan Implications
πΈ Effects of Perennial Nature on Growth and Flowering
The Chamaedorea Palm is known for its enchanting small flowers that can bloom year-round, given the right conditions. These delicate blooms add a touch of elegance to any space, but their frequency can vary based on environmental factors like light and humidity.
Optimal conditions, such as consistent warmth and adequate moisture, can significantly enhance flowering. Conversely, fluctuations in temperature or light can lead to reduced flowering, reminding us that this palm thrives best when its needs are met.
β³ Expected Lifespan and Influencing Factors
On average, the Chamaedorea Palm enjoys a lifespan that can exceed 10 years, making it a long-term companion in your garden. However, several factors can influence its longevity.
Soil quality, water availability, and light conditions play crucial roles in determining how long your palm will thrive. Poor soil or inconsistent watering can lead to stress, while ample sunlight can boost its health and vitality.
As the palm ages, you may notice signs of decline, such as yellowing leaves or stunted growth. Recognizing these indicators early can help you take action to revitalize your plant and extend its life.

Dormancy and Seasonal Changes
π± Description of Dormancy Periods
Chamaedorea palms experience distinct dormancy phases, particularly during the cooler months. During this time, you may notice slowed growth and reduced leaf production, signaling that the plant is conserving energy.
Identifying these dormancy signs is crucial for proper care. Recognizing when your palm is resting helps you adjust your maintenance routine accordingly.
π‘οΈ Seasonal Changes in Growth and Care
As temperatures rise, Chamaedorea palms enter an active growth phase. This is when youβll see vibrant new leaves and a boost in overall health.
During dormancy, care adjustments are essential. Reduce watering and fertilization to match the plant's lower energy needs, ensuring it remains healthy until the next growth cycle.

Variations Across Climate Zones
Differences in Perennial Behavior in Various Climates π
The Chamaedorea Palm showcases remarkable adaptability across different climate zones. In tropical regions, it thrives with lush growth and vibrant foliage, while in temperate areas, it may exhibit slower growth rates and require more care.
Humidity and temperature play crucial roles in its development. High humidity levels promote robust growth, whereas cooler temperatures can slow down its lifecycle, affecting overall health and flowering patterns.
